Entrepreneur? Problems? Time For A Change? 5 Quick Tips
I do it, perhaps you do it, I know many others do it.
You get up in the morning and before you know it, you’re in bed without having achieved very much during the day. I have called it “working on the infrastructure”, perhaps you have called it something different, like “wasted time”.
The only thing we are all equal in is we have a set amount of time each and every day to accomplish the tasks we need to do most.
Far too often, we get distracted and before you know it, another SO-SO day has passed
So, as an entrepreneur, what tips can you specifically apply to get things done?
1. All the P’s - Preparation & Planning Prevent Piss Poor Performance. Plan your activities during the working day, you may want to take a look at the Block Method for more info. Be ruthless with your time! Leave that email alone!!! Time-box your activities and make sure they are prioritised.
2. Curb Distractions! - As with email, the phone can be a big distractor, you need to avoid “chatting” like the plague. Personal phone calls and activities need to be kept to a minimum. You can’t just stop and drop everything just because a friend or family member calls - again be ruthless and tell them you’ll phone them back in the evening. Make sure they know you have fixed working hours during which you would rather not be disturbed.

4. Get your head straight - You’re not an employee anymore. You’re a business owner and you have to do lots of other things a business owner has to do. You need to motivate yourself now, no one will stand over you watching anymore.
5. Get Rid Of It - Outsource as much as possible as soon as possible. Every conceivable task associated with your business must be outsourced (which truthfully does not need your input). This is the only way you will gain control of your life and scale your business.
6. Take A Break - All work and no play makes Tom a dull boy (I should know). It is far too easy to slip into the “I’ve just got to get this finished” mode and let your health and family life suffer in an effort to build your business empire. Guess what - keep up with that approach and you can guarantee one thing: failure.
So, in summary - you have to be ruthless and disciplined with your time. If you’re not, time will be ruthless in it’s second by second disciplined way with you!
